Improvement of traffic percolation based on bottlenecks
The formation process of global traffic flow from isolated local traffic flows can be considered as a percolation process. During this transition, the critical traffic bottleneck plays an important role in maintaining the global functional connectivity of the whole system. However, little attention has been paid to how the traffic percolation will be benefited from the improvements of traffic percolation bottlenecks. Here, we study the improvement of traffic bottlenecks in a traffic model and find that the traffic bottlenecks can greatly affect the organization efficiency of traffic flow. We propose a method of traffic bottlenecks load-reducing, which shows a significant improvement of traffic percolation on the network scale under different traffic conditions. Comparing with different methods, we demonstrate the advantage of the method of traffic bottlenecks load-reducing in the improvement of traffic percolation. Our findings may provide new insights for the research of bottlenecks and develop effective measures to improve the traffic reliability in real traffic.
